Vikings' defense 'broke a little bit' in late loss to Lions

MINNEAPOLIS -- Before Sunday, the last time the Minnesota Vikings had blown a lead in the final minute of a game was Oct. 19, 2014, in a game that would provide teachable moments by the bushel for a first-year head coach and his young team.

The Vikings lost 17-16 that day when Kyle Orton marched the Bills 80 yards in 15 plays, aided by a fourth-and-20 conversion when Chad Greenway was a step late in covering Scott Chandler after trying to get Captain Munnerlyn lined up, and a 28-yard gain when Xavier Rhodes didn't get tight enough coverage on Chris Hogan.
